Texas moves to No. 6 in Rivals industry rankings after flipping five-star DL James Johnson
Texas landed a massive commitment by flipping five-star defensive lineman James Johnson. That now puts Texas at No. 6 in Rivals industry rankings.
The Texas Longhorns are on cloud nine after winning the recruiting battle for five-star linebacker Tyler Atkinson and also pulling off a major flip by snagging five-star defensive lineman James Johnson from Georgia on Tuesday.
The addition of Johnson has catapulted the Longhorns up the recruiting rankings significantly. Texas now holds the No. 6 class per Rivals industry rankings.
Johnson is joined at the top of the class for Texas with Atkinson as well as five-star quarterback Dia Bell and five-star edge Richard Wesley. Other big-time pledges include four offensive lineman John Turntine, four-star athlete Jermaine Bishop, four-star cornerback Samari Matthews, and four-star defensive lineman Vodney Cleveland.
Of all the players just mentioned, Bell is the only one who hasn't committed since May (he committed last June). Kudos should be given to head coach Steve Sarkisian and his staff for landing so much premium talent over the last few months.
